Factors Affecting Cost

  • Extent of Damage: Minor cracks may only need simple patching, while major structural issues could require extensive repairs.
  • Type of Repair: Different repair methods, such as resurfacing versus complete slab replacement, will vary in cost.
  • Materials Used: The quality and type of materials used for the repair can significantly affect the price.
  •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ary based on the expertise of the contractor and the complexity of the repair.
  • Location: Prices can fluctuate depending on the local market and availability of specialized contractors in Daphne, AL.
  • Pool Size: Larger pools will generally require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Accessibility: If your pool is difficult to access, additional equipment or labor may be needed, raising the cost.

Common Tasks and Costs

Task Average Cost (Daphne, AL)
Minor Crack Repair $200 - $500
Resurfacing $3,000 - $5,000
Full Slab Replacement $10,000 - $15,000
Leak Detection and Repair $300 - $1,000
Structural Reinforcement $2,000 - $4,000
Waterproofing $1,000 - $2,500
Pool Deck Repair $1,500 - $3,500
